Elton – On May 9, 2025, shortly before 3:00 p.m., Louisiana State Police Troop D began investigating a serious injury crash involving a single-vehicle and a train at the railroad crossing located on Liberty Cemetery Road just north of U.S. Highway 190 in Allen Parish. The crash claimed the life of 20-year-old Jashawn Lavan of Kinder.
The preliminary investigation revealed that Lavan was driving a 2008 Honda Accord north on Liberty Cemetery Road approaching a railroad crossing. For reasons still under investigation, the Honda stopped on the railroad tracks in front of the approaching train. As a result, the train struck the left side of the vehicle.
Lavan, who was properly restrained at the time of the crash, sustained serious injuries and was transported to a local hospital where he later died.
A standard toxicology sample was collected and submitted for analysis. This crash remains under investigation.
